HEADLINES

A sheep nicknamed Dolly becomes the first mammal to be cloned… A 17-yearold fan is crushed to death at a Smashing Pumpkins gig in Dublin…

The cultural phenomenon that is Pokémon is launched on an unsuspecti­ng universe via a pair of videogames… Alice In Chains play their final gig with singer Layne Staley, who subsequent­ly retreats from public life.

MOVIE

Robert Rodriguez’s brilliantl­y trashy vampire epic, From

Dusk Till Dawn, complete with legendary strip bar Titty Twister, is released… Wes Craven’s ace postmodern horror Scream becomes the movie that launched a thousand masks.

CHARTS

All-conquering girl band The Spice Girls shoot to fame with their first single, Wannabe, while footie anthem Three Lions is released in time for the Euro 96 championsh­ip. Not that it helped the England team much. Ozzy Osbourne, who launches the first Ozzfest as a twoday festival held in Phoenix, Arizona and Devore, California. The bill features Slayer, Danzig, Biohazard, Sepultura, Fear Factory and… er, Narcotic Gypsy (don’t worry, we don’t remember them either).

RIP

Sublime singer Bradley Nowell (heroin overdose)… Smashing Pumpkins keyboard player Jonathan Melvoin (heroin overdose)… Body Count drummer Beatmaster V (leukaemia).

VILLAIN

Axl Rose – at least according to Slash, who quits Guns N’ Roses, leaving Duff McKagan the only other original member.
